Prone swinging, where a child lays on their stomach to swing, is against the rules at many schools, but can be extremely beneficial to their development.
Physical and Motor Development
Swinging on their stomach requires children to use their core muscles, as well as muscles in the back and neck. This strengthens their core, and can improve posture.
Sensory Processing and Regulation
The consistent, rhythmic, linear movement of swinging provides vestibular input. This can help calm the nervous system and help children get focused and grounded.
Feeling their weight against the swing gives proprioceptive input, which enhances body awareness and control.
Activities that provide proprioceptive and vestibular input can help support impulse control and reduce unsafe sensory seeking behaviors.
